I. There is established within the department of environmental services the New Hampshire healthy tidal waters and shellfish protection program. This program ensures that water quality in coastal waters supports the propagation, conservation, and harvest of shellfish. II. To the extent that funds are available, the department shall:

(a)Exercise and administer the classification of coastal waters under New Hampshire shellfish sanitation control authority, pursuant to RSA 143:21 and RSA 143:21-a, so that all waters suitable for shellfish propagation and harvest are classified, and, to the maximum extent possible, classified areas are approved for harvest of shellfish, in accordance with the National Shellfish Sanitation Program.
